I am however experiencing a problem with your skin and PseudoTV Live that other people have had, as described in this post by kixcl: http://forum.xbmc.org/showthread.php?tid...pid1720891
I believe I have found a fix for the problem and am posting it here in hopes that it may help other users of both Amber and PTVL.
In "VideoFullScreen.xml" file, near the top (line 3 or 4) is the following line:
Code:
<onunload>Dialog.close(all,true)</onunload>
When I remove it, PseudoTV Live functions properly and from what I can see, with limited testing so far, Amber also continues to work properly. I will post back here if I encounter any errors from my simple edit. Obviously, to anyone else trying this, make a backup copy of the xml file first.
Note that I am using Frodo and I know you don't support that anymore but I think the line of code also exists in the Gotham version of Amber.
